Growing up in Los Angeles, I remember the last Friday 10:00 a.m. civil defense sirens going off.  I always thought that if the Soviets were going to attack us, the last Friday at 10 o'clock would be the time to do it.  Everyone would think it was a test.

The sirens have long been silent.  The system no longer works.  It was disconnected in 1985.  However, most of the sirens still dot the landscape, monuments to the Cold War.
